Project Estimator

WSP is currently initiating a search for a Project Estimator to join our Estimating team. This individual will report to our client's office in Amarillo, TX (Hybrid 2 times per week). Employees may travel to a WSP office (Fort Worth, TX) for periodic meetings.

This Opportunity

The Project Estimator contributes to the development of cost estimates for a range of infrastructure and building projects by applying established knowledge of estimating methods and construction practices. This role performs quantity take-offs, supports pricing and scope analysis, and assists with developing detailed cost data in alignment with client and project requirements. With guidance, the position begins to take responsibility for discipline-specific estimating tasks and deliverables. The position supports to estimate development and review activities that inform planning and decision making, with a focus on consistency, transparency, and adherence to defined estimating standards.

Your Impact

Interpret project specifications, drawings, and scope documentation to identify relevant cost components

Perform quantity take-offs for multiple construction disciplines, including civil, structural, architectural, and mechanical systems

Input and maintain estimate information using approved estimating software and templates

Research and apply appropriate labor and material cost information based on location, project type, and duration

Assist in the preparation of detailed cost breakdowns appropriate to the phase of work

Contribute to the development of direct and indirect cost estimates for construction work

Coordinate with discipline leads, designers, and engineers to clarify design assumptions and construction methods

Develop cost comparisons and variance reports to evaluate alternatives and value engineering options

Track estimate versions and maintain organized documentation for internal review and audit purposes

Assist with the creation of scope clarifications, inclusions, and exclusions for bid proposals

Support the development of unit pricing, productivity rates, and escalation factors in estimate development

Participate in internal estimate reviews and provide input on cost drivers and risk areas

Perform site visits or attend pre-bid meetings as needed to support estimating tasks

Ensure compliance with corporate standards, estimating procedures, and client-specific requirements

Maintain records of assumptions, methods, and reference data used in each estimate

Assist in the evaluation of historical project data to support benchmarking and cost validation

Contribute to cost modeling and early-stage budgeting efforts for feasibility studies or conceptual designs

Collaborate with internal stakeholders to ensure accuracy, consistency, and completeness of estimates

Analyze historical project cost data to identify trends, ratios, and cost drivers that support estimate development

Participate in training, development, and process improvement initiatives to enhance estimating capability

Exercise responsible and ethical decision-making regarding company funds, resources, and conduct, and adhere to WSP's Code of Conduct and related policies and procedures

Perform additional responsibilities as required by business needs
